Exhibit 3.1

 

CERTIFICATE OF DESIGNATION

of

SERIES 2 REDEEMABLE PREFERRED STOCK

 

GWG HOLDINGS, INC. 

 

 

 

(Pursuant to Section 151(g) of the

Delaware General Corporation Law)

 

 

 

 

GWG HOLDINGS, INC.,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”), hereby certifies as of February 16, 2017 (the “Filing Date”), that the following resolution was duly adopted by the Board of Directors of the Company (the “Board”), effective as of February 10, 2017, pursuant to Section 151(g) of the Delaware General Corporation Law (the “DGCL”):

 

RESOLVED, that pursuant to the authority vested in the Board of Directors of the Company by the Company’s Certificate of Incorporation, and in accordance with the Delaware General Corporation Law, Section 151, the Board of Directors hereby states the authorized number and terms of a new class of preferred stock of the Company, to be entitled “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ock,” and fixes the relative powers, privileges, preferences and rights, and the qualifications, limitations and restrictions, thereof as follows:

 

1.       Designation and Amount. The shares of such series shall be designated as “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ock,” and the number of shares constituting the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all be 1,000,000. Such number of shares may be increased or decreased by resolution of the Board adopted and filed pursuant to the DGCL, Section 151(g), or any successor provision; provided, however, that no decrease shall reduce the number of authorized sh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ock to a number less than the number of such shares then outstanding plus the number of shares reserved for issuance upon the exercise of any then-outstanding options, warrants, convertible or exchangeable securities or other rights for the purchase of sh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, if any.

 

2.       Stated Value.

 

(a)       Each share of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all have a stated value equal to $1,000 (the “Stated Value”). If at any time after the Filing Date the Company effects (i) a stock dividend payable in sh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, (ii) a subdivision of the outstanding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ock into a greater number of sh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, or (iii) a combination of the outstanding sh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, by reclassification or otherwise, into a lesser number of sh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then, in any such case, the Stated Value in effect immediately prior to such event shall, concurrently with the effectiveness of such event, be proportionately decreased or increased, as appropriate.

(b)       Upon any adjustment of the Stated Value of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then and in each such case the Company shall give written notice thereof to the registered holders of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ock (“Holders”), which notice shall state the new stated value resulting from such adjustment and set forth in reasonable detail the method of calculation and the facts upon which such calculation is based.

 

3.       Ranking. As to the payment of dividends and the distribution of assets of the Company upon its liquidation, dissolution or winding up, the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all rank as follows: (a) senior to the Company’s common stock; (b) pari passu with the Company’s Series A Convertible Preferred Stock and the Company’s Redeemable Preferred Stock; and (c) senior to or pari passu with all other classes and series of the Company’s preferred stock.

 

4.       Dividends in Cash or in Kind.

 

(a)       Holders shall be entitled to receive for each share of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, and the Company shall pay, subject to the provisions of the DGCL and legally available funds therefor, preferential cumulative dividends at the per annum rate of 7.0% on the Stated Value, payable in arrears in monthly installments on the 15th day of the next following month (or if such date is not a business day, then the next following business day), when and as declared by the Board (the “Preferred Dividends”), (i) in cash out of legally available funds, or (ii) at the Company’s option, in duly authorized, validly issued, fully paid and non-assessable sh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ock. Preferred Dividends on sh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all also be payable upon any Redemption Date, as defined below, and upon the final distribution date relating to a Liquidation Event, as defined below.

 

(b)       Preferred Dividends shall cease to accrue on sh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ock on the day immediately prior to any Redemption Date, as defined in Section 9(a) below, and on the final distribution date relating to a Liquidation Event.

 

(c)       Regular dividends shall be payable to the Holders, in accordance with the DGCL, as of each regular record date that is the final business day of a calendar month that is also a day on which the Company’s common stock trades or is eligible for trading on the primary market for such stock. Notwithstanding the foregoing, Holders as of a regular record date must have held their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ock for more than two business days (each of which must also have been a trading day on which the Company’s common stock traded or was eligible for trading on the primary market for such stock) in order to be eligible to receive a dividend payment on the next payment date. If the Company’s common stock no longer trades or is eligible for trading on a trading market, then the requirement in the prior two sentences that a business day shall be a “trading day” shall not apply. In the case of payment by the Company of dividends in the form of sh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, such stock shall be valued at the Stated Value.

(d)       Preferred Dividends shall be calculated on the basis of a calendar year consisting of twelve 30-day months (or 360 days), and shall begin to accrue on outstanding sh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ock from the date of each share’s original issuance until paid, whether or not declared. Preferred Dividends shall accrue whether or not there are profits, surplus or other funds of the Company legally available for the payment of dividends at the time such Preferred Dividends become payable or at any other time. Preferred Dividends shall be cumulative from the date of issue, whether or not declared for any reason, including if such declaration is prohibited under applicable law or any outstanding indebtedness or borrowings of the Company or any of its subsidiaries, or any other contractual provision binding on the Company or any of its subsidiaries.

 

(e)       No dividend shall be declared on any other series or class or classes of capital stock to which the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ock ranks senior or pari passu as to dividends or liquidation, including without limitation shares of common stock, in respect of any period, nor shall any series or class of capital stock that ranks junior or pari passu to the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ock be redeemed, purchased or otherwise acquired for any consideration (or any money to be paid into any sinking fund or otherwise set apart for the purchase of any such junior stock), unless all accrued and unpaid Preferred Dividends through the most recent payment date have been or contemporaneously are declared and paid on all then-outstanding shares of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ock; provided, however, that this restriction shall not apply to the repurchase by the Company of (i) shares of common stock from employees, officers, directors, consultants or other persons performing services for the Company or any of its subsidiaries pursuant to agreements under which the Company has the right or option to repurchase such shares upon the occurrence of certain events or otherwise, (ii) shares of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ock pursuant to the terms of the Certificate of Designation for such preferred stock, or terms superior to those contained within such Certificate of Designation, or (iii) shares of Redeemable Preferred Stock pursuant to the terms of the Certificate of Designation for such preferred stock, or terms superior to those contained within such Certificate of Designation.

 

5.       Liquidation Preference.

 

(a)       In the event of (i) the sale, conveyance, exchange or other disposition of all or substantially all of the assets of the Company, (ii) any acquisition of the Company by means of a consolidation, stock exchange, stock sale, merger or other form of corporate reorganization with any other entity in which the Company’s stockholders prior to any such transaction own less than a majority of the voting securities of the surviving entity (a “Change-in-Control Transaction”), or (iii) the winding up or dissolution of the Company, whether voluntary or involuntary (each such event described in clause (i), (ii) and (iii), a “Liquidation Event”), the Board shall determine in good faith the amount legally available for distribution to stockholders after taking into account the distribution of assets among, or payment thereof over to, creditors of the Company in the manner required by the DGCL (the “Net Assets Available for Distribution”). Subject to the provisions of Section 5(d) below, each Holder shall be entitled to be paid out of the Net Assets Available for Distribution, and before any payment or distribution is made to the holders of any class of capital stock ranking junior to the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, and on a pari passu basis with holders of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ock, Redeemable Preferred Stock and any other class or series of capital stock then ranking pari passu with the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ock (if the Liquidation Event triggers a payment obligation on such classes), for each then-outstanding share of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ock held by such Holder, an amount equal to the Stated Value, as adjusted, plus all accrued and unpaid Preferred Dividends thereon (the “Liquidation Amount”). Notwithstanding the foregoing, a transaction shall not constitute a Liquidation Event if the Board shall have approved such transaction and the sole purpose of the transaction is to change the jurisdiction in which the Company is incorporated or create a holding company with substantially similar series and classes of capital shares, each having substantially the same terms as those that existed immediately prior to the transaction and owned in the same proportions by the persons or entities who held the Company’s securities immediately prior to such transaction. Holders of a majority of the sh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, voting as a single class, may vote to determine whether a transaction which otherwise constitutes a Liquidation Event shall be deemed not to be a Liquidation Event for purposes of this Section 5(a).

(b)       If the amount of the Net Assets Available for Distribution is insufficient to pay the full Liquidation Amount, then such Net Assets Available for Distribution shall be distributed ratably to the Holders in proportion to the respective amounts to which such Holders would otherwise be entitled.

 

(c)       If any distribution contemplated in this Section 5 is payable in securities or property other than cash, then the value of such distribution shall be the fair market value of such distribution as determined in good faith by the Board.

 

(d)       In connection with the occurrence of a Change-in-Control Transaction, Holders of a majority of then-outstanding sh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ock may vote to receive, in lieu of cash in an amount per share equal to the Liquidation Amount, securities of the successor or purchasing corporation having the same or substantially identical rights, preferences and privileges as the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ock held immediately prior to such Change-in-Control Transaction.

 

6.       Voting. Except as otherwise set forth herein or as required by law, Holders shall not be entitled to vote on any matter on account of their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ock. If the DGCL requires the vote of the Holders, voting as a separate class, to authorize an action of the Company, then the affirmative vote of the Holders of a majority of then-outstanding sh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all constitute the approval of such action by the class, unless the DGCL requires a different threshold, in which case such different threshold shall apply.

 

7.       Certain Notices. The Company will provide the Holders with prior written notice of any meeting of the stockholders of the Company and written notice of any action taken by the stockholders of the Company without a meeting. The Company will also provide the Holders with at least 20 days’ written notice prior to the consummation of any transaction described in Section 5(a), clauses (i) or (ii), constituting a Liquidation Event.

8.       Protective Provisions. In addition to any other vote or consent required herein or by law, the affirmative vote or written consent of Holders of a majority of then-outstanding sh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, voting together as a single class, given in writing or by a vote at a meeting, shall be required for the Company to:

 

(a)       amend or waive any provision of this Certificate of Designation or otherwise take any action that modifies any powers, rights, preferences, privileges or restrictions of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ock (other than an amendment solely for the purpose of changing the number of sh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ock designated for issuance hereunder, as contemplated in Section 1 above);

 

(b)       authorize, create or issue shares of any class of stock having rights, preferences or privileges upon a liquidation of the Company that are superior to the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ock; or

 

(c)       amend the Certificate of Incorporation of the Company in a manner that adversely and materially affects the rights of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ock.

 

9.       Redemption and Repurchase.

 

(a)       Redemption Request by a Holder.

 

(i)       Upon receipt of a written notice from a Holder requesting that the Company redeem all or any portion of such Holder’s share(s) (the “Holder Redemption Notice”), the Company may choose to (but shall not be obligated to) redeem the applicable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ock for the Redemption Price, as defined in Section 9(b)(i), subject, however, to the applicable redemption fee specified below:

 

(A)       if the Holder Redemption Notice is given prior to or on the first an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then a 12% redemption fee shall apply;

 

(B)       if the Holder Redemption Notice is given after the first an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ock and prior to or on the second an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then a 10% redemption fee shall apply;

 

(C)       if the Holder Redemption Notice is given after the second an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ock and prior to or on the third an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then a 8% redemption fee shall apply; and

 

(D)       if the Holder Redemption Notice is given after the third an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then no redemption fee shall apply.

(ii)       Within 30 days after the Company’s receipt of the Holder Redemption Notice, the Company shall provide written notice to such requesting Holder specifying whether all or a portion of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ock sought to be redeemed pursuant to the Holder Redemption Notice will be repurchased by the Company (which the Company shall determine in its discretion) (the “Company Redemption Response”). If all or any portion of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ock is to be repurchased by the Company, then the Company Redemption Response shall specify the date on which such repurchase and redemption shall occur (the “Redemption Date”), which date shall be no more than 60 days after the giving of the Holder Redemption Notice, and the Company Redemption Response shall include the stock power, if required, described in paragraph (iv) below.

 

(iii)       On any Redemption Date and in accordance with this Section 9(a), the Company will, to the extent that it has sufficient funds to consummate a redemption, as determined by the Company in its discretion, and to the extent that it may then lawfully do so under the DGCL and such payment is further permitted under the Company’s Certificate of Incorporation (including all related certificates of designation), and any borrowing agreements to which it or its subsidiaries are bound (the “Borrowing Agreements”), in connection with the delivery by such Holder of the applicable items described in paragraph (iv) below, redeem the shares specified in the Company Redemption Response by paying in cash, via wire transfer of immediately available funds to an account designated in writing by the Holder, an amount per share equal to the applicable Redemption Price.

 

(iv)       On or before a Redemption Date, the applicable Holder shall deliver to the Company a stock power duly executed (in the form provided by the Company together with the Company Redemption Response).

 

(v)       From and after the Redemption Date, (A) the shares identified in the Company Redemption Response shall be cancelled on the books and records of the Company, (B) the right to receive Preferred Dividends thereon shall cease to accrue, and (C) all rights of the Holder of the shares to be redeemed shall cease and terminate, excepting only the right to receive the Redemption Price therefor (which right shall be contingent upon the Holder delivering the stock power required under paragraph (iv) above); provided, however, that if as of the close of business on the Redemption Date the Company has not paid the Redemption Price with respect to such Holder (other than any case in which the Redemption Price has not been paid due to a failure by the Holder to deliver the stock power required under paragraph (iv) above), then the shares to be redeemed shall remain issued and outstanding, and all rights of such Holder with respect to such shares shall continue.

 

(vi)       If, on any Redemption Date, the Company (A) is unable, by virtue of applicable law or provisions in its Certificate of Incorporation (including all related certificates of designation), to redeem sh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, or (B) cannot redeem sh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ock without constituting a default under any Borrowing Agreements, then such redemption obligation shall be discharged promptly after the Company becomes able to discharge such redemption obligation under applicable law and without causing or constituting a default under Borrowing Agreements, with all such deferred redemption obligations being satisfied on a prorated basis and regardless of the order in which any Holder Redemption Notices shall have been received by the Company. If and so long as the redemption obligation with respect to sh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ock has not been fully discharged, the Company shall not declare or make any dividend or other distribution on any junior class or series of capital stock or directly or indirectly redeem, purchase or otherwise acquire for any consideration any shares of a junior class or series of capital stock or discharge any optional redemption, sinking fund or other similar obligation in respect of any such junior class or series of capital stock; provided, however, that this restriction shall not apply to the repurchase by the Company of shares of (x) common stock from employees, officers, directors, consultants or other persons performing services for the Company or any of its subsidiaries pursuant to agreements under which the Company has the right or option to repurchase such shares upon the occurrence of certain events or otherwise, or (y) Series A Convertible Preferred Stock pursuant to the terms of the Certificate of Designation of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ock or terms superior to those contained within such Certificate of Designation of Series A Convertible Preferred Stock.

(b)       Redemption at the Option of the Company.

 

(i)       The Company shall have the right (but not the obligation) to redeem sh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ock at a price per share equal to the Stated Value plus an amount equal to all accrued and unpaid Preferred Dividends thereon (whether or not declared), up to but not including the Company Redemption Date, as defined below (such amount, the “Redemption Price”); provided, however, that if the Company redeems any sh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ock prior to the one-year anniversary of their issuance, then the Redemption Price shall include a premium equal to the amount by which the Redemption Price (calculated as above) is less than 107% of the Stated Value of those shares. To exercise this redemption right, the Company shall deliver written notice to each Holder that all or part of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ock will be redeemed (the “Company Redemption Notice”) on a date that is no earlier than 20 and no later than 60 days after the date of the Company Redemption Notice (such date, the “Company Redemption Date”); provided, however, that if the Company elects to redeem less than all of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, it shall do so ratably among all Holders.

 

(ii)       On the Company Redemption Date and in accordance with this Section 9(b), the Company will, at its option (to the extent it may then lawfully do so under the DGCL, and for so long as (A) a redemption is permitted under the Company’s Certificate of Incorporation (including all related certificates of designation), and (B) such redemption does not constitute a default under any Borrowing Agreements), redeem the shares specified in the Company Redemption Notice by paying in cash, via wire transfer of immediately available funds to the respective accounts designated in writing by the applicable Holders, an amount per share equal to the Redemption Price.

 

(iii)       On or before the Company Redemption Date, each Holder whose shares are being redeemed under this Section 9(b) shall deliver to the Company a stock power, duly executed (in the form provided by the Company together with the Company Redemption Notice).

(iv)       From and after the Company Redemption Date, (A) the shares identified in the Company Redemption Notice shall be cancelled on the books and records of the Company, (B) the right to receive Preferred Dividends thereon shall cease to accrue, and (C) all rights of Holders with respect to the shares to be redeemed shall cease and terminate, excepting only the right to receive the Redemption Price with respect to such shares (which right shall be contingent upon the Holder delivering the stock power required under paragraph (iii) above); provided, however, that if as of the close of business on the Redemption Date the Company has not paid the Redemption Price with respect to such Holder (other than any case in which the Redemption Price has not been paid due to a failure by the Holder to deliver the stock power required under paragraph (iii) above), then the shares to be redeemed shall remain issued and outstanding, and all rights of such Holder with respect to such shares shall continue.

 

(c)       Repurchase in the Event of Death, Disability or Bankruptcy.

 

(i)       Subject to the terms of this Section 9(c), within 45 days of the death, Total Permanent Disability or Bankruptcy, as each such term is defined in paragraph (iv) below, of a Holder or Beneficial Holder, as defined below (a “Holder Repurchase Event”), the estate of such Holder or Beneficial Holder (in the event of death) or such Holder or Beneficial Holder or his or her legal representative (in the event of Total Permanent Disability or Bankruptcy) may request that the Company repurchase, in whole but not in part, without penalty, the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ock held by such Holder (including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ock of the Holder held in his or her individual retirement accounts) or Beneficial Holder by delivering to the Company a written request for repurchase (a “Repurchase Request”). Any such Repurchase Request shall identify the applicable Holder Repurchase Event. If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ock is held jointly by natural persons who are legally married, then a Repurchase Request may be made by (A) the surviving Holder (or Beneficial Holder) upon the occurrence of a Holder Repurchase Event arising by virtue of a death, or (B) the disabled or bankrupt Holder or Beneficial Holder (or his or her legal representative) upon the occurrence of a Holder Repurchase Event arising by virtue of a Total Permanent Disability or Bankruptcy. If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ock is held together by two or more natural persons that are not legally married (regardless of whether held as joint tenants, co-tenants or otherwise), then none of such co-Holders shall have the right to make a Repurchase Request unless a Holder Repurchase Event has occurred for each such co-Holder. A Holder that is not an individual natural person does not have the right to make a Repurchase Request.

(ii)       Upon receipt of a Repurchase Request, the Company shall designate a date for the repurchase of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ock (the “Repurchase Date”), which date shall not be later than the 60th day after the Company is provided with facts or certifications establishing, to the reasonable satisfaction of the Company, the occurrence of the Holder Repurchase Event. On the Repurchase Date, the Company shall, to the extent that it may then lawfully do so under the DGCL and such payment is further permitted under its Certificate of Incorporation (including related certificates of designation) and any Borrowing Agreements, pay the Holder or Beneficial Holder, or the estate of the Holder or Beneficial Holder, an amount per share equal to the Stated Value plus all accrued and unpaid Preferred Dividends thereon (whether or not declared), up to but not including the Repurchase Date (the “Repurchase Price”).

 

(iii)       From and after the Repurchase Date, (A) the shares being repurchased pursuant to the Repurchase Request shall be cancelled on the books and records of the Company, (B) the right to receive Preferred Dividends thereon shall cease to accrue, and (C) all rights of the Holder with respect to the shares being repurchased shall cease and terminate, excepting only the right to receive the Repurchase Price with respect to such shares (which right shall be contingent upon the Holder delivering a stock power relating to the shares to be repurchased); provided, however, that if as of the close of business on the Repurchase Date the Company has not paid the Repurchase Price (other than any case in which the Repurchase Price has not been paid due to a failure by the Holder to deliver a required stock power), then the shares to be repurchased shall remain issued and outstanding, and all rights of such Holder with respect to such shares shall continue.

 

(iv)       For purposes of this Section 9(c):

 

(A)       “Bankruptcy” means, with respect to a Beneficial Holder or Holder who is an individual natural person, the (1) commencement of a voluntary bankruptcy case by that Beneficial Holder or Holder; (2) consent to the entry of an order for relief against such Beneficial Holder or Holder in an involuntary bankruptcy case; or (3) consent to the appointment of a custodian of such Beneficial Holder or Holder or for all or substantially all of such person’s property;

 

(B)       “Beneficial Holder” means an individual natural person that holds a beneficial interest in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ock through a custodian or nominee, including a broker-dealer; and

 

(C)       “Total Permanent Disability” means, with respect to a Beneficial Holder or Holder who is an individual natural person, a determination by a physician approved by the Company that such person, who was gainfully employed and working at least 40 hours per week as of the date on which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ock was purchased, has been unable to work 40 or more hours per week for at least 24 consecutive months.

10.       Conversion.

 

(a)       Conversions at Option of Holder. Holders have the right and option to partially convert their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, at any time and from time to time, into that number of shares of common stock determined by dividing the Stated Value of such sh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ock by the Conversion Price, as defined below; provided, however, that:

 

(i)       no more than 10% of the Stated Value of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ock originally purchased from the Company may be converted into common stock;

 

(ii)       no sh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ock issued by the Company as Preferred Dividends, and no accrued but unpaid Preferred Dividends, may be converted into common stock; and

 

(iii)       upon the giving of a Company Redemption Notice, the right to convert sh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ock that are subject to redemption shall be suspended through the Company Redemption Date.

 

Holders shall effect conversions by delivering to the Company a conversion notice in the form provided by the Company (a “Notice of Conversion”). Each Notice of Conversion shall specify the number of sh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ock to be converted, and the date on which such conversion is to be effected (the “Conversion Date”), which date may not be prior to the date the applicable Notice of Conversion is delivered to the Company. If no Conversion Date is specified in a Notice of Conversion, then the Conversion Date shall be the date that such Notice of Conversion is deemed given under Section 15 below.

 

(b)       Conversion Price. The conversion price for the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all be the volume-weighted average price of the Company’s common stock for the 20 trading days immediately prior to the date of conversion of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ock (the “Conversion Price”), subject, however, to the applicable Conversion Price discount specified below:

 

(i)       if the Notice of Conversion is given prior to or on the third an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then no discount on the Conversion Price shall apply;

(ii)       if the Notice of Conversion is given after the third an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ock and prior to or on the fourth an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then a 6% discount on the Conversion Price shall apply;

 

(iii)       if the Notice of Conversion is given after the fourth an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ock and prior to or on the fifth an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then an 8% discount on the Conversion Price shall apply; and

 

(iv)       if the Notice of Conversion is given after the fifth anniversary of the issuance of such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, then a 10% discount on the Conversion Price shall apply.

 

Notwithstanding the foregoing, the Conversion Price shall in no event (including after the application of discount as specified above) be less than $12.75 per share, subject, however, to equitable adjustment upon stock dividends, subdivisions or combinations, by reclassification or otherwise.

 

(c)       Mechanics of Conversion.

 

(i)       Not later than five business days after each Conversion Date (the “Share Delivery Date”), the Company shall deliver, or cause to be delivered, to the converting Holder a certificate representing the Conversion Shares or shall deliver Conversion Shares electronically through the Depository Trust Company or another established clearing corporation performing similar functions. “Conversion Shares” means, collectively, the shares of common stock issued and issuable upon conversion of the sh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ock in accordance with the terms hereof.

 

(ii)       Failure to Deliver Certificates. If, in the case of any Notice of Conversion, such certificate(s) are not delivered to or as directed by the applicable Holder by the Share Delivery Date, then such Holder shall be entitled to elect, by written notice to the Company at any time on or before such Holder’s receipt of such certificate(s), to rescind such Conversion Notice, in which event such Holder shall promptly return to the Company any common stock certificates issued to such Holder pursuant to the rescinded Conversion Notice.

 

(iii)       Reservation of Shares Issuable Upon Conversion. The Company covenants that it will at all times reserve and keep available out of its authorized and unissued shares of common stock, for the sole purpose of issuance upon conversion of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ock as herein provided, free from preemptive rights or any other actual contingent-purchase rights, that number of shares of common stock that would be issuable upon the conversion of all then-outstanding sh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ock eligible for conversion hereunder. The Company covenants that all shares of common stock so issuable shall, upon issuance, be duly authorized, validly issued, fully paid and non-assessable.

(iv)       No Fractional Common Shares. No fractional common shares or scrip representing fractional common shares shall be issued upon the conversion of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ock. As to any fraction of a common share which the Holder would otherwise be entitled to receive upon a conversion, the Company shall, at its election, either pay a cash adjustment in respect of such final fraction in an amount equal to such fraction multiplied by the Conversion Price, or round up or down to the nearest whole share (with even halves rounded up).

 

(v)       Transfer Taxes and Expenses. The issuance of certificates representing shares of the common stock issued upon conversion of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ock shall be made without charge to any Holder for any documentary stamp or similar taxes that may be payable in respect of the issue or delivery of such certificates; provided, however, that the Company shall not be required to pay any tax that may be payable in respect of any transfer involved in the issuance and delivery of any such certificate upon conversion in a name other than that of the Holders; and provided, further, that the Company shall not be required to issue or deliver such certificates unless or until the Holder requesting the issuance thereof has paid to the Company the amount of such tax or has established to the satisfaction of the Company that such tax has been paid. The Company shall pay all transfer agent fees required for the processing of any Notice of Conversion.

 

11.       No Sinking Fund. The Company shall not be required to establish any sinking or retirement fund with respect to the sh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ock.

 

12.        Fractional Shares.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ock may be issued in fractional shares.

 

13.       Loss, Theft or Destruction. Upon receipt of evidence satisfactory to the Company of the loss, theft, destruction, or mutilation of certificates, if any, representing sh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ock, and receipt of indemnity or security reasonably satisfactory to the Company (or in the case of mutilation, upon surrender and cancellation of the mutilated certificate), the Company shall cause to be made, issued and delivered, in lieu of such lost, stolen, destroyed or mutilated certificate, a new certificate of like tenor.

 

14.       Holder of Record Deemed Absolute Owner. The Company may deem the Holder in whose name shares of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ock is registered upon the books and records of the Company to be, and may treat such Holder as, the absolute owner of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ock for the purpose of paying Preferred Dividends, paying the Redemption Price, and for all other purposes, and the Company shall not be affected by any notice to the contrary. All such payments shall be valid and effectual to satisfy and discharge the liability of the Company in respect of the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ock to the extent of the sum or sums so paid.

16.       Reacquired Shares. If any Series 2 Redeemable Preferred Stock is exchanged, redeemed, purchased or otherwise acquired by the Company in any manner, then those shares shall be cancelled, and upon such cancellation shall be returned to the pool of authorized but undesignated and unissued shares of preferred stock of the Company, and thereafter may be reissued as part of a new series of preferred stock of the Company to be created by resolution of the Board as permitted by the DGCL and the Company’s Certificate of Incorporation.

 

17.       Severability. If any provision of this Certificate of Designation, or the application thereof to any person or entity or any circumstance, is invalid or unenforceable, then (i) a suitable and equitable provision shall be substituted therefor in order to carry out, so far as may be valid and enforceable, the intent and purpose of such invalid or unenforceable provision, and (ii) the remainder of this Certificate of Designation and the application of such provision to other persons, entities or circumstances shall not be affected by such invalidity or unenforceability, nor shall such invalidity or unenforceability affect the validity or enforceability of such provision, or the application thereof, in any other jurisdiction.
